| Teaching materials are important texts for the realization of national education goals,content carriers for teacher-student interaction in class,and Windows for students to develop their own abilities and explore the mathematical world.Teaching materials are the source of college entrance examination.Therefore,how to grasp the source of teaching material is of great significance to guiding teaching and reviewing.In this paper,the three-dimensional geometry of the recent five years of the college entrance examination mathematics questions as the target question(namely the target question)is studied,it is found that a large proportion of the target questions of the college entrance examination come from the three-dimensional geometry part of the textbook examples and exercises(namely the source question).In view of the above problems,first of all,a comparative study is conducted on the target questions and textbook questions in the recent five years,and a comprehensive difficulty model is introduced to evaluate the consistency relationship between the two questions.It is found that the ratio of target question and source question in five dimensions tends to be about 1.3,which confirms the highly matched characteristics of the two questions.In addition,the situation difficulty of the textbook source questions is significantly higher than that of the college entrance examination target questions.Secondly,on this basis,the content of target traceability is further analyzed,and the process of three-dimensional geometric target traceability for2017-2021 college entrance examination is elaborated in detail.Three types of target questions derived from source questions are summarized: situational variation(20.40%),factor variation(62.22%)and question type variation(17.38%).Finally,based on the above three traceability forms,the corresponding teaching enlightenment and teaching design cases are proposed. |
